What is a Fistula?

A fistula is an abnormal connection or passageway between two organs or vessels that are not normally connected. This can happen due to infection, inflammation, trauma, surgery, or certain diseases such as Crohn’s disease. Fistulas can occur in many areas, including the gastrointestinal tract (like an anal fistula), urinary tract, or blood vessels (arteriovenous fistulas). They can lead to complications such as chronic infection, fluid loss, discomfort, and disruption of normal bodily functions.

Types of Fistulas

  • Anal FistulaAn abnormal connection between the anal canal and the skin near the anus, often following an abscess.
  • Enterocutaneous FistulaA passage between the intestine and the skin, usually after abdominal surgery or trauma.
  • Arteriovenous FistulaA direct connection between an artery and a vein, sometimes created intentionally for hemodialysis.
  • Obstetric or Gynecological FistulasSuch as vesicovaginal fistulas, which connect the bladder and the vagina, often due to childbirth complications.

Reasons for Ligation

Ligation of a fistula is performed primarily to close the abnormal passage and prevent complications. Depending on the type and location of the fistula, ligation can be done using various surgical techniques. The main reasons for ligating a fistula include reducing infection risk, preventing chronic drainage, preserving organ function, and improving patient comfort and quality of life.

Preventing Infection

Fistulas can allow bacteria, stool, or other fluids to bypass normal anatomical barriers, leading to recurrent or chronic infections. Ligation helps to close the passage, thereby eliminating the pathway through which bacteria can travel. This reduces the risk of repeated abscess formation, cellulitis, or systemic infections such as sepsis. By addressing the source of infection, ligation promotes healing and prevents further complications.

Restoring Normal Function

Many fistulas interfere with the normal functioning of organs. For example, an anal fistula can cause pain, difficulty controlling bowel movements, and persistent drainage, while a gastrointestinal fistula can lead to fluid and nutrient loss, malnutrition, and electrolyte imbalances. Ligation of the fistula restores normal anatomy, allowing the affected organs to function properly. This improves digestion, continence, or vascular flow depending on the type of fistula.

Reducing Discomfort and Improving Quality of Life

Persistent fistulas often cause discomfort, pain, and social embarrassment due to continuous drainage or odor. By surgically ligating the fistula, patients experience significant relief from these symptoms. Pain is reduced, hygiene is easier to maintain, and social confidence improves. Overall, ligation contributes to better physical and mental well-being for the patient.

Surgical Techniques for Fistula Ligation

There are several surgical methods used to ligate a fistula, depending on its location, size, and complexity. Some common techniques include

Fistulotomy and Ligation

In this method, the fistula tract is opened, cleaned, and then ligated to prevent recurrence. This technique is often used for simple anal fistulas and allows for proper healing while minimizing damage to surrounding tissues.

Endoscopic or Minimally Invasive Techniques

For certain gastrointestinal fistulas, endoscopic approaches can be used to ligate the fistula without large incisions. Clips, sutures, or other closure devices may be employed to seal the abnormal connection. This approach reduces recovery time and limits surgical trauma.

Vascular Fistula Ligation

Arteriovenous fistulas, whether congenital or acquired, may require ligation to redirect blood flow or prevent complications such as heart strain or swelling. This is commonly done under local or regional anesthesia with careful imaging guidance to ensure precise closure.

Postoperative Care and Considerations

After ligation of a fistula, proper postoperative care is essential for successful healing. Patients may be prescribed antibiotics to prevent infection, pain management medications, and dietary or lifestyle adjustments depending on the type of fistula treated. Regular follow-up is important to monitor for recurrence, ensure wound healing, and assess the function of the affected organs.

Potential Risks and Complications

Like any surgical procedure, fistula ligation carries potential risks, including

  • Recurrence of the fistula if the tract is not completely closed.
  • Infection or delayed wound healing.
  • Damage to surrounding tissues or organs.
  • Temporary or permanent functional changes, such as incontinence after anal fistula ligation.

When Ligation is Preferred

Ligation is usually recommended when conservative treatments such as antibiotics, drainage, or observation fail to resolve the fistula. It is particularly indicated for fistulas that are chronic, symptomatic, or causing complications such as infection, pain, or impaired organ function. The decision to ligate is made after careful assessment by a surgeon, often involving imaging studies to map the fistula tract and plan the safest and most effective approach.
